Nondestructive Testing Potential of a Magnetoacoustic Storage Correlator (MASC)
A simple magnetoacoustic storage correlator (MASC) was tested as a pulse compressor in an ultrasonic nondestructive testing application. The pulse compression ratio reached was 30. Higher compression ratios are readily available through choice of different device lengths and device operating regime. The system is flexible; it is not limited to any particular type of large time-bandwidth signal. The correlator reference signal is easily programmable and erasable, and can be changed at any time. This system offers real-time correlation signal processing at a repetition rate that is only limited by the temporal length of the large time-bandwidth signal
